Valley Children's Children's Book Series
 
        
            To celebrate the wonder and imagination of childhood, Valley Children's has published a collection of books, including a series starring our beloved mascot, George the Giraffe. George represents the heart of Valley Children’s – kindness, caring for others and comforting those who need our help. Books in George's series are written and illustrated by local moms who all have a personal connection to Valley Children’s.
As part of our commitment to children's well-being, Valley Children’s Literacy Program will add these books to their distribution of approximately 2,000 books a month to kids from Bakersfield to Modesto. The intent of the program is to place new books in the hands of children in a region with some of the lowest literacy rates in the nation and to improve early literacy by instilling in children a love of reading.
Valley Children's books are currently available for purchase at various locations throughout the Central Valley. Proceeds benefit Valley Children’s patients and programs, and support our mission of providing the best healthcare for children.

        A Home for George
        
        This hardcover children’s book for preschoolers to adults tells the story of how George found his home at Valley Children’s Hospital. "A Home for George" is dedicated to the five Founding Mothers of Valley Children’s: Carolyn Peck, Agnes Crocket, Gail Goodwin, Helen Maupin and Patty Randall.

              Juan Felipe Herrera
            
Juan Felipe Herrera has written two books for Valley Children’s patients, families and staff, who served as inspiration for his work. Born in Fowler and moving across Southern and Central California as his parents moved with the seasons as farmworkers, Juan Felipe went on to obtain degrees from UCLA, Stanford and the University of Iowa. In 2015, he was named the United States Poet Laureate, one of dozens of recognitions, awards and distinctions of his remarkable career.
